Mull Mahmood Site
SindhSettlementProtected
Mull Mahmood site lies about 16 km south-west of Kadhan town, it can be accessed from Kadhan town towards Bahdmi village and onwards to Mull Mahmood Site. The site of Mull Mahmood consists of four mounds designated as mound 1, 2, 3, and 4. The surface of these mounds is strewn with bricks and brick bats. On mound 1 there was evidence of some buried structural remains, but no identifiable cultural material was found on any of the mounds other than burnt bricks and brick bats, due to salinity. Two sizes of burnt bricks were found (29.2 x 21.5 x 5 cm) and (22.9 x 17.7 x 3.8 cm), the site has been encroached by modern graveyard.
